What are the closest inpatient rehab centers to Weirsdale, FL, and how do they differ?

While Weirsdale itself is a small community, nearby cities like Ocala, Leesburg, and The Villages offer several inpatient facilities. These centers vary in their approaches, with some focusing on medical detox and dual-diagnosis treatment, while others may emphasize faith-based or holistic therapies. It's important to research facilities in these neighboring areas to find one that aligns with your specific treatment needs and insurance coverage.

How can I find local outpatient support groups for addiction in the Weirsdale area?

Weirsdale residents can access support through groups like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) that meet in nearby communities such as Belleview, Lady Lake, and Leesburg. Additionally, the Marion County and Lake County health departments provide directories for local recovery meetings and outpatient counseling services, which are crucial for ongoing support after initial treatment.

Does Weirsdale, FL, have any specialized rehab programs for seniors or retirees, given the local demographic?

Yes, due to the significant retiree population in Central Florida, several rehab centers in the region, particularly in The Villages and Ocala, offer programs tailored for seniors. These programs often address age-specific issues like polypharmacy (multiple prescriptions), chronic pain management, and isolation, using a slower-paced, more medically supervised approach to ensure safety and effectiveness.

What should I expect from the admissions process at a rehab center serving Weirsdale residents?

The admissions process typically begins with a confidential phone assessment to evaluate your needs, often conducted by centers in Ocala or Leesburg. You'll discuss insurance verification, medical history, and substance use to determine the appropriate level of care—whether inpatient, outpatient, or detox. Many facilities offer assistance with travel arrangements from Weirsdale, as most are located 20-45 minutes away.
